Output d558078816c19b61e488faf444667d7ca90eaa0879c0128d1b1f9704eef5b8f3:0

value
2815000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d13bb21a2318cf9516b562e64e8304b354bb53b OP_EQUAL
address
3ABAQKKSZq2mEcv5Mxmf81HuaRPrXjAeGQ
transaction
d558078816c19b61e488faf444667d7ca90eaa0879c0128d1b1f9704eef5b8f3
spent
true